Lecithin Composition

2021-09-28
Lecithin is mainly composed of glycerol skeleton, a phosphate group, two fatty acids (the number of carbon atoms is usually even, such as 16,18,20, and often contains unsaturated fatty acids), and head groups of different polarity. Among them, lecithin, according to the different polar group head and including phosphatidyl choline (PC, that is, in a narrow sense of lecithin, choline) and phosphatidyl ethanolamine (PE, also called cephalin, ethanol amine molecules), phosphatidyl inositol (PI, inositol molecules), phosphatidylserine (PS, serine molecules), phosphatidic acid (PA) and double phosphatidyl glycerol (DPG, Cardiolipin).
